While NVIDIA dominates 92% of the AI semiconductor market, Fujitsu has taken a completely different approach from GPUs. They plan to manufacture an inference-focused NPU using Rapidus's 1.4nm process, completing the entire process from design to mass production entirely domestically. What does this "different path" signify?
